Doctor Zhivago must close in Brisbane on Sunday 14 August.
These final two weeks at QPAC will mark the last chance for Australian audiences to see this epic new musical for quite some time. With its soaring melodies, incredible sets, luxurious costumes, and extraordinary powerful story that takes in fifty years, two world wars and one of the greatest love stories ever told, the show has been describes as “the Les Mis of the 21st Century” by the Courier Mail. Starring Anthony Warlow as the ardent young Doctor Yurii Zhivago, Lucy Maunder as the alluring Lara, and Taneel Van Zyl in the role of his wife Tonia, the show is based on the famous novel by Boris Pasternak. The show also stars Martin Crewes, Bartholomew John, Peter Carroll and Trisha Noble.
